Chelsea striker Michy Batshuayi turns focus to Arsenal after Qarabag goal

GETTY Michy Batshuayi has started just one of Chelsea's four Premier League games so far The Blues’ back-up striker scored last night for Chelsea in their 6-0 drubbing of Azerbaijani outfit Qarabag in the Champions League. Batshuayi scored Chelsea’s fifth at Stamford Bridge as he continues to press Antonio Conte for a starting role. “It was good for the team,” Batshuayi said. “The clean sheet also and for me and for Marcos Alonso, Davide Zappacosta and N’Golo Kante, it was our first game in the Champions League and to win the first game is very good.” Summer signing Alvaro Morata has settled in now following his £70m arrival from Real Madrid....
